Amy Gerard hits a very real breaking point this episode and it’s the kind every mum will instantly recognise. From the mental load of parenting to the small moments that quietly build into something bigger, Amy opens up about the realities of juggling family life, relationships and everything in between. On this episode of the Chris & Amy Podcast, the conversation dives into modern motherhood, relationship pressures, and the everyday chaos that comes with raising kids. Amy shares the honest thoughts many women have but don’t always say out loud, while Chris brings his usual mix of humour and “helpful” commentary.
